Measurement of azimuthal hadron asymmetries in semi-inclusive deep inelastic scattering off unpolarised nucleons

The COMPASS collaboration
Nucl.Phys.B 886 (2014) 1046-1077, 2014.

Abstract (data abstract)
CERN-NA. Spin-averaged asymmetries in the azimuthal distributions of positive and negative hadrons produced in deep inelastic scattering were measured using the CERN SPS muon beam at 160 GeV and a Li6D target during 2004. The amplitudes of the three azimuthal modulations COS(PHI(HADRON)), COS(2*PHI(HADRON)) and SIN(PHI(HADRON)), ASYMUU(COS(PHI(HADRON))), ASYMUU(COS(2*PHI(HADRON))) and ASYMUU(SIN(PHI(HADRON))) respectively, were obtained by binning the data separately in each of the relevant kinematic variables XB, Z or PT(HADRON) and binning in a three-dimensional grid of these three variables.
